Perceptif



Example: Elle est très perceptive aux émotions des autres en réunion.

Definition


"Perceptif" describes someone who is very attentive and able to notice or understand things quickly, especially emotions or subtle details. For example, a person who is "perceptif" can easily sense the feelings of others in a meeting.

Etymology


The word "perceptif" comes from the Latin word 'percipere,' meaning 'to grasp or seize.' It entered French by combining 'per-' (through) and 'capere' (to take), reflecting the idea of keenly taking in or perceiving information.
